Rice, beans cheaper as oil, processed foods rise

Food prices showed mixed trends across major Nigerian markets in January, offering some relief for households through lower prices of staple grains such as rice and beans, even as rising costs of cooking oils and processed foods continued to strain food budgets. Nigerian families spent less in 2024 over price hike – Report

Household consumption in Nigeria contracted sharply in real terms in 2024 as surging prices eroded the purchasing power of millions of families, according to provisional data contained in the Central Bank of Nigeria’s latest statistical bulletin. Prices of food items dropped in September, says NBS

The National Bureau of Statistics says prices of beans, garri, maize, tomatoes, beef, rice, and other food items witnessed a slight decrease in price in September 2025. Farmers lament as food prices soar

Nigerian farmers claim that despite massive investments made in the agriculture industry, the cost of goods and food continues to rise. According to The Punch, farmers from various regions of the country also attributed the failure of the government’s agricultural intervention schemes to the absence of key sector stakeholders’ input throughout the plan development process. Nigeria, others face severe food crisis amid Ukraine war – Report

Nigeria and 44 other countries around the world are severely exposed to the Ukraine war-induced food crisis, a study by Boston Consulting Group, a global management consulting firm, has shown.
